A064049 Number of possible arrangements of numbers 1 to n*(n+1)/2 in a triangle of n rows so that each row and each diagonal is increasing or decreasing. 2
1, 6, 24, 180, 4212, 461064, 302693712 (list; graph; refs; listen; history; text; internal format)
OFFSET
1,2
LINKS
EXAMPLE
The following triangle of 4 rows satisfies the requirements:
....1
...3 2
..4 5 8
.6 7 9 10
CROSSREFS
a(n)=6*A064050(n) for n>1.
